Meet the New MLA Board
 
President Jim Bishop thanks Guy McGillivray for his service to MLA.
At the recent MLA Fall Fling, November 10-11, in Branson, Missouri, a new Board was installed, led by President Chris Cleaver, Cleaver Farm & Home, Chanute, Kansas. Here is the complete list of Board members:
 
President - Chris Cleaver, Cleaver Farm & Home, Chanute, Kansas
1st Vice President - Adam Hendrix, Chic Lumber & Hardware, St. Peters, Missouri
2nd Vice President - Hatch McCray, McCray Lumber Millwork, Kansas City, Kansas 
3rd Vice President - Matt Graham, Miltonvale Lumber, Miltonvale, Kansas
NLBMDA Delegate - Greg Smith, E.C. Barton Co., Jonesboro, Arkansas
Secretary/Treasurer - Dan Prendergast, Moscow Mills Lumber, Moscow Mills, Missouri
Immediate Past President - Jim Bishop, Vesta Lee Lumber, Bonner Springs, Kansas
Missouri/Arkansas Director - Landon Garner, Garner Building Supply, Rogers, Arkansas
Kansas/Oklahoma Director - Ray Mueller, Clark Lumber Do it Center, Herington, Kansas
Arkansas Committee Representative - Brandie Killian, John Plyler Home Center, Glenwood, Arkansas
Kansas Committee Representative - Position currently vacant
Missouri Committee Representative - Darrell Derstler, Derstler Lumber, Richmond, Missouri
Oklahoma State Representative - Gary Smith, Smith & Sons Bldg. Center, Anadarko, Oklahoma

If you missed the Fall Fling, you missed a great program. It was headlined by Dena Cordova-Jack, BlueTarp, and Thea Dudley, Guardian, speaking on "The Seven Deadly Sins in Credit and Finance." Then, Jim Welch gave an outstanding presentation on "Becoming a True Growth Leader." Finally, Robert Uhler provided an update on "OSHA's Top Ten." Dealers who attended will have a head-start on others with the great ideas picked up at the conference.
 
At the meeting, Robert Uhler became the Executive Vice President of MLA. He is moving into this role as Olivia Holcombe takes on a more active role with our management group, Western Equipment Dealers Association. We look forward to continued success for MLA with Robert's leadership.

Are You Ready for the New Overtime Rules?   Starting Dec. 1, more employees will be eligible for overtime pay for hours worked in excess of 40 per week. Even with the Republican wins last week, there may not be enough time to overturn or change the rule before its December 1 effective date. For more information about the changes, click here .

NLBMDA Calls for a New Softwood Lumber Agreement... The National Lumber and Building Material Dealers Association released a comprehensive overview of the softwood lumber dispute between the United States and Canada. The report details the background of the dispute, the recently expired 2006 Softwood Lumber Agreement, and the ongoing negotiations to create a new deal between the two nations.
 
After discussing the dispute in detail, the NLBMDA concludes that a new softwood lumber agreement (SLA) is necessary. Read more .
